Transaction 20f36b4f584e109cc4d61dfa500a1a1c95250797868d4edc5c4424bc82d835fc
1 Input
2 Outputs
- 20f36b4f584e109cc4d61dfa500a1a1c95250797868d4edc5c4424bc82d835fc:0
- 20f36b4f584e109cc4d61dfa500a1a1c95250797868d4edc5c4424bc82d835fc:1
value 23741
address 1yK54KXQhX2nDmjsPE1FDAPUQ7chrNGD2
value 10554553
address 31o8i1HWnnGmP6fbnfM2vdNzxU1tDZfrPM